The Pokémon Company has announced that two classic Pokémon games will be available on Nintendo Switch Online from today.

As per the latest Pokémon Presents broadcast, those with a subscription to the Nintendo Switch Online service can now play both Pokémon Stadium 2 on the Nintendo 64 and the Game Boy Color title Pokémon Trading Card Game right now. Each game is available via the Switch Online’s classic game catalogue, and features all the usual upgrades including save states and more, similar to the existing N64 and Game Boy Color games available on the service.

Pokémon Stadium 2 is of course the sequel to the N64 original game that, when they first released, saw Pokémon rendered in 3D for the first time. However, this follow-up includes even more Pokémon than before, as it not only includes the first 151 monsters but now adds a hundred more from the games Pokémon Gold and Silver. In addition, the follow up adds a whole new range of mini-games for you to play either alone or with friends.

Pokémon Trading Card Game, meanwhile, is an RPG that swaps the usual monster hunting for, you guessed it, battles based on the Trading Card Game spin-off from the series. It’s got a wholly original story and its own rules, and is a classic for the discerning Pokémon fan who might not have played this spin-off before.

You’ll need the Nintendo Switch Online + Expansion Pack subscription to play Pokémon Stadium 2, but you should be able to play Pokémon Trading Card Game with just a standard Nintendo Switch Online subscription. Both are available now from their respective classic games tile on the Nintendo Switch dashboard.
